UA Bundle SDK .NET
2.2.3.276
|
An interface to an object that allows updating of historical data. More...
Inherited by UnifiedAutomation.UaServer.BaseNodeManager.
Public Member Functions | |
StatusCode | BeginHistoryUpdateDataTransaction (RequestContext context, uint totalItemCountHint, TransactionType transactionType, Delegate callback, object callbackData, out HistoryDataTransactionHandle handle) |
Begins the history transaction. More... | |
void | FinishHistoryUpdateDataTransaction (HistoryDataTransactionHandle transaction) |
Finishes the history transaction. More... | |
StatusCode | BeginHistoryUpdateData (HistoryDataOperationHandle operationHandle, UpdateDataDetails details) |
Begins an operation to update raw history data. More... | |
StatusCode | BeginHistoryUpdateStructureData (HistoryDataOperationHandle operationHandle, UpdateStructureDataDetails details) |
Begins an operation to update structured history data. More... | |
StatusCode | BeginHistoryDeleteRaw (HistoryDataOperationHandle operationHandle, DeleteRawModifiedDetails details) |
Begins an operation to delete raw history data. More... | |
StatusCode | BeginHistoryDeleteAtTime (HistoryDataOperationHandle operationHandle, DeleteAtTimeDetails details) |
Begins an operation to delete history data at specific times. More... | |
An interface to an object that allows updating of historical data.
StatusCode UnifiedAutomation.UaServer.IHistoryUpdateDataManager.BeginHistoryDeleteAtTime | ( | HistoryDataOperationHandle | operationHandle, |
DeleteAtTimeDetails | details | ||
) |
Begins an operation to delete history data at specific times.
operationHandle | The operation handle. |
details | The details. |
If this method returns Good the callback passed to BeginHistoryUpdateDataTransaction must be called when the operation completes.
Implemented in UnifiedAutomation.UaServer.BaseNodeManager.
StatusCode UnifiedAutomation.UaServer.IHistoryUpdateDataManager.BeginHistoryDeleteRaw | ( | HistoryDataOperationHandle | operationHandle, |
DeleteRawModifiedDetails | details | ||
) |
Begins an operation to delete raw history data.
operationHandle | The operation handle. |
details | The details. |
If this method returns Good the callback passed to BeginHistoryUpdateDataTransaction must be called when the operation completes.
Implemented in UnifiedAutomation.UaServer.BaseNodeManager.
StatusCode UnifiedAutomation.UaServer.IHistoryUpdateDataManager.BeginHistoryUpdateData | ( | HistoryDataOperationHandle | operationHandle, |
UpdateDataDetails | details | ||
) |
Begins an operation to update raw history data.
operationHandle | The operation handle. |
details | The details. |
If this method returns Good the callback passed to BeginHistoryUpdateDataTransaction must be called when the operation completes.
Implemented in UnifiedAutomation.UaServer.BaseNodeManager.
StatusCode UnifiedAutomation.UaServer.IHistoryUpdateDataManager.BeginHistoryUpdateDataTransaction | ( | RequestContext | context, |
uint | totalItemCountHint, | ||
TransactionType | transactionType, | ||
Delegate | callback, | ||
object | callbackData, | ||
out HistoryDataTransactionHandle | handle | ||
) |
Begins the history transaction.
context | The request context. |
totalItemCountHint | The total item count hint. |
transactionType | Type of the transaction. |
callback | The callback. |
callbackData | The callback data. |
handle | The historical data transaction handle. |
Implemented in UnifiedAutomation.UaServer.BaseNodeManager.
StatusCode UnifiedAutomation.UaServer.IHistoryUpdateDataManager.BeginHistoryUpdateStructureData | ( | HistoryDataOperationHandle | operationHandle, |
UpdateStructureDataDetails | details | ||
) |
Begins an operation to update structured history data.
operationHandle | The operation handle. |
details | The details. |
If this method returns Good the callback passed to BeginHistoryUpdateDataTransaction must be called when the operation completes.
Implemented in UnifiedAutomation.UaServer.BaseNodeManager.
void UnifiedAutomation.UaServer.IHistoryUpdateDataManager.FinishHistoryUpdateDataTransaction | ( | HistoryDataTransactionHandle | transaction | ) |
Finishes the history transaction.
transaction | The transaction. |
Implemented in UnifiedAutomation.UaServer.BaseNodeManager.